DON’T the Council realise that a lot of people come to March to shop from the outlying villages as there is plenty of free parking. Also, the many charity shops in March are manned by unpaid volunteers using their own petrol to drive into town and work for free for up to eight hours a day. If they then have to pay to park for that amount of time I am sure they would think again about coming.
Think about the people living in the nearby roads who will then have people parking there all day. How about people using the library, swimming pool etc. They will think twice in these circumstances.
The council should think again before we became the same as Wisbech with even more empty shops.
BETTY PECORINI
